PURPOSE:To efficiently assemble a liquid crystal display which is sealed by a ultraviolet-ray setting type bonding agent with high accuracy, by using a pressing means, positioning means, and ultraviolet-ray irradiating means to plural glass electrode substrates under a combined condition. CONSTITUTION:A front glass electrode substrate 1 and a rear glass electrode substrate 18 are temporarily bonded to each other via a ultraviolet-ray setting type bonding agent layer 3 mixed with a spacer 20, and the electrode patterns of both the substrates 1 and 18 are made to coincide with each other by operating positioning means 9-16 while watching them through a microscope 23 after the substrates 1 and 18 are put on a table 6. Then, the substrates 1 and 18 are pressed by lowering a pressure barrel 22 by means of a pressing means 21, and then, the substrates 1 and 18 are bonded to each other by irradiating ultraviolet rays from a ultravoilet-ray irradiating device 24 and curing the bonding agent. |
